WHO ARE WE

Parse Biosciences is a global life sciences company whose mission is to accelerate progress in human health and scientific research. Empowering researchers to perform single cell sequencing with unprecedented scale and ease, our pioneering approach has enabled groundbreaking discoveries in cancer treatment, tissue repair, stem cell therapy, kidney and liver disease, brain development, and the immune system.

With technology developed at The University of Washington, Parse has raised over $100 million in capital and is now used by over 2,000 customers across the world. Our growing portfolio of products includes Evercode Whole Transcriptome, Evercode TCR, Gene Capture, and a data analysis solution.

Parse Biosciences is based in Seattle, Washington's vibrant South Lake Union district, where we recently opened a 34,000 square foot headquarters and state-of-the-art laboratory.

THE POSITION

As a Technical Sales Manager, you will be responsible for achieving sales objectives for our single cell RNA sequencing products through the development of new business and management of current customer accounts. You will be expected to create and execute a sales strategy across academic, biotech, and pharmaceutical accounts while working closely with Field Application Scientists and other Parse team members. Candidates should have strong technical skills, sales skills, the ability to develop and manage customer relationships, and a drive to overachieve. Gaining a deep understanding of the single cell market and Parse's products will be critical to success.

TERRITORY AND TRAVEL

You will ideally be based in Seattle, WA or The San Francisco area, and you will cover the following states/regions: North Bay, California, Washington, Oregon and Idaho. The position will require travel (being in the field) approximately 50% of the time.
